Airlines operating competitive connections on this Honolulu to Hobart corridor include Qantas, Air New Zealand, Singapore Airlines, United Airlines, and Delta Air Lines. Each carrier structures the routing differently, with common connection points through Sydney, Auckland, Melbourne, and Singapore. Choosing the right airline depends on your preferred layover city, onboard product priorities, and schedule flexibility — factors a knowledgeable Personal Travel Manager evaluates on your behalf before presenting options.

The Honolulu to Hobart routing rewards travelers who plan with a degree of flexibility. Because Hobart is a secondary Australian airport rather than a major hub, the final leg of most itineraries involves a short domestic connection — typically through Sydney or Melbourne. Understanding how that connection affects total elapsed time, baggage handling, and lounge access requires routing expertise that generic booking engines simply cannot replicate, which is precisely where a dedicated Personal Travel Manager adds measurable value.
Travelers comparing airlines on this route should consider that a 14.2-hour average journey time means your choice of long-haul business class product — specifically the lie-flat bed quality and catering on the primary transpacific or transaustralian segment — has a direct impact on how you arrive in Hobart. Singapore Airlines routing through Singapore, for example, adds geographic distance but may offer a superior onboard experience on the primary long-haul segment depending on aircraft assignment.
